Basketball Recap: Hinkley Thunder vs. Kennedy Commanders
Hinkley was not able to break out of their rough patch on Thursday as the team picked up their 23rd straight loss dating back to last season. They took a 60-48 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Kennedy Commanders. The Thunder were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Commanders apparently hadn't forgotten their defeat the last time these teams played back in January of 2024.

Despite the loss, Hinkley still got an impressive performance from Malachi Holden, who dropped a double-double with 19 points and 17 boards. With that strong performance, Holden is now averaging an impressive 8.2 rebounds per game. Another player making a difference was Jazae Pogue, who posted eight points.
Even though they lost, Hinkley sm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 17 offensive rebounds.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Kennedy only seven offensive boards.
Kennedy was led to victory by Anthony Zink and Quinn Padilla. Zink went 11-for-17 en route to 28 points and six boards, while Padilla went 5-for-9 to rack up 14 points in addition to eight steals and five rebounds. What's more, Zink also posted a 65% shooting accuracy, which is the highest he's achieved since back in December of 2024. Isaac Trujillo was another key player, putting up two points along with nine assists and three steals.
Hinkley's loss dropped their record down to 0-20. As for Kennedy, their record is now 4-17.
Coming up, Hinkley will take on Greeley West at 2:00 p.m. on Saturday. Hinkley is facing Greeley West at the right time seeing as Greeley West is stuck on a 17-game losing streak. As for Kennedy, they did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next contest, a 40-33 defeat against Lincoln on the 21st.
